Joe Pass plays funk? Check out the master of mellow guitar, Joe Pass, as he takes on the only thing scarier than a broken string – jazz funk!
Originally released on session legend Carol Kaye’s short lived California label, Gwyn Records, in 1970, the album saw Joe Pass as he explored a genre that was quickly making waves – jazz funk. From album opener and title track “Better Days”, it’s immediately clear that this isn’t your average Joe Pass album. As Kaye’s iconic Fender bass mingles with Marvin Gaye collaborator Paul Nelson Humphrey’s simple yet solid drumming, it’s impossible to mistake this for Pass’s earlier works. Yet his tone is as sweet and mellow as ever, with his masterful bebop soloing a welcome respite from the wah’d out funk guitar playing of the time. Despite his gentle tone, the grooves are deep and rhythmic – ranging from the bossa-inspired “Balloons”, to the lively bass-driven funk of “Head Start”. Of course, it wouldn’t be a Joe Pass record without a solo track. Album closer “We’ll be Together Again” sees Pass alone – his masterful chord-melody techniques and phrasing on full display as he manipulates tempo and time. The subtle tape hiss practically accompanies Pass until the rhythm section comes in – with the quartet’s simple, elegant playing bringing the album to a gentle close. Condition Ratings
- MINT (M): Perfect, brand new, unplayed.
- Near Mint (NM): Like new, barely played, will play perfectly.
- Excellent (EX): Very close to near mint, with minor cosmetic wear. Will play perfectly.
- Very Good Plus (VG+): Light cosmetic blemishes that do not affect play. Close to perfect playback.
- Very Good (VG): Some light marks that may cause minor noise during playback. Still enjoyable and plays well.
- Good Plus (G+): Noticeable noise during playback. Only listed if of collector value. Not ideal for listening.
